Overview

Based on the true story of famed social psychologist Stanley Milgram, who in 1961 conducted a series of radical behavior experiments that tested ordinary humans’ willingness to obey authority by using electric shock. We follow Milgram from meeting his wife through his controversial experiments that sparked public outcry.

Experimenter – Psychology, Power, and Obedience

Experimenter: The Obedience Trials explores the life and controversial experiments of social psychologist Stanley Milgram. Best known for his shocking obedience studies in the 1960s, the film examines how ordinary people respond to authority—even when it conflicts with their morals.

A Thought-Provoking Look at Human Behavior

Blending biopic and experimental storytelling, Experimenter challenges viewers to question how far we’ll go when instructed by authority—and what that reveals about our nature.
